History made as Journal Radio goes live

David Banks, Journal columnist and former Daily Mirror editor who chaired the first Journal Radio show

IT was a historic day yesterday as The Journal became the first regional newspaper to launch a radio station.

The community radio site was launched online at 12.30pm with an hour-long phone-in hosted by our columnist David Banks.

Readers had the chance to air their views on stories making the headlines.

David, a former editor of the Daily Mirror, chaired the show from a studio in his home in North Northumberland.

He said: “It went well for a first time but it would have gone a damn site better if I hadn’t accidentally unplugged my microphone socket minutes before we went on air!

“We’re community radio, broadcasting especially to Journal readers about affairs and events in our community. It is real community radio where people in the region can have their say and talk to the people who write for them every day.”
